Growth Ability - Recent 8 Quarters
Numbers in millionsRevenueOperating IncomeNet IncomePretax MarginEPSRevenue Growth Rate YOYRevenue Growth Rate Avg of 2 QuartersRevenue Growth Rate QoQEPS Growth Rate YOYEPS Growth Rate Avg of 2 QuartersEPS Growth Rate QoQNet Margin Growth Rate YOYNet Margin Growth Rate QoQ
2024-12123N/A3125.42%1.29-3.39%75.21%-7.63%21.7%N/AN/A17.62%1.27%
2024-09133N/A3325.1%N/A153.82%78.13%-4.54%N/AN/AN/A-63.14%-15.87%
2024-06140N/A4129.83%1.662.44%4.04%-30.88%-1.19%13.73%-35.16%-9.44%-7.27%
2024-03202N/A6532.17%2.565.63%N/A58.5%28.64%N/A141.51%12.81%48.89%
2023-12127N/A2721.61%1.06N/AN/A142.68%N/AN/A-22.06%N/A-68.26%
2023-0952313568.08%1.36N/AN/A-61.47%N/AN/A-19.05%N/A106.66%
2023-06136N/A4532.94%1.68N/AN/A-28.72%N/AN/A-15.58%N/A15.51%
2023-03192N/A5428.52%1.99
Growth Ability - Recent 5 Years
Numbers in millionsRevenueOperating IncomeNet IncomePretax MarginEPSRevenue Growth RateOperating Income Growth RateNet Income Growth RateNet Margin Growth RateEPS Growth Rate
2024-09604N/A16827.83%6.6293.08%N/A2.9%-46.71%10.52%
2023-0931319016352.22%5.99-45.28%-2.14%4.62%91.2%13.88%
2022-0957219415627.31%5.2615.09%17.77%10.36%-4.11%20.09%
2021-0949716514128.48%4.38

Disclaimer

All the information on the website is for reference only. If the user trades according to this information, he/she shall be responsible for any transaction loss. This website is not responsible for any errors in the content of the information or delay in updating.